I have just noticed that 2 contacts are missing from outlook xp. There may be
others, I don't know. This is the first time in 1 year or more since I last
tried to access these 2 contacts in outlook.

How can contacts disappear from outlook?

Is there a way to prevent them from disappearing?

Can I get them back, or do I need to re-enter them as new contacts?

ctc wrote:

I have just noticed that 2 contacts are missing from outlook xp.
There may be others, I don't know. This is the first time in 1 year
or more since I last tried to access these 2 contacts in outlook.

How can contacts disappear from outlook?


The only way I know is by you deleting them. Contacts aren't included in
autoarchive, so that's not the way it happened.
